Pre-issue figures use the shareholding reported in the RHP; post-issue figures use the shareholding once the fresh issue has created new shares. The two differ because of that dilution and because post-issue earnings per share are often annualised, so the change can run in either direction. Market capitalisation is calculated at the ₹384 offer price. Compare the post-issue P/E against listed peers before deciding — a premium there is growth you are paying for in advance.

Where the money goes

₹398.79 Cr of the issue is earmarked to named objects.

Repayment of certain company borrowings ₹225.98 Cr
Purchase and setup of new machinery at 2 plants ₹87.02 Cr
Purchase and setup of a rooftop solar power plant for power generation at our Supa Facility ₹8.83 Cr
General corporate purposes ₹76.96 Cr

About the company

KSH International Limited is an India-based company engaged in the manufacturing of electrical components, with a strong focus on power connection and distribution solutions. The company was established with the aim of catering to the growing demand for reliable electrical infrastructure across industries. Over the years, it has built a solid presence in both domestic and international markets by consistently delivering quality products. The promoters of the company bring significant industry experience, which has helped in strengthening operational capabilities and expanding its customer base across sectors such as power, railways, renewable energy and industrial applications.

The company offers a wide range of products including cable lugs, connectors, earthing solutions and other electrical accessories used in transmission and distribution networks. KSH International follows a B2B business model, supplying its products to government utilities, EPC contractors and private sector clients. Its operations are supported by in-house manufacturing facilities and a focus on quality standards, enabling it to maintain long-term relationships with customers. By emphasising product reliability, timely delivery and continuous improvement, the company aims to sustain growth and enhance its position in the electrical components industry.
